What Makes APAR’s E-beam Technology Special?

So, what exactly is E-beam technology, and why should you care? Imagine giving cable insulation a super-powered shield. That’s essentially what we do. E-beam technology uses a focused beam of electrons to strengthen the molecular structure of cable insulation.

We use radiation, like that used in nuclear physics and medical isotopes, to cure polymers to give them improved characteristics. The cables will have higher temperatures, heat and melt resistance, abrasion resistance and extended operating life. But it’s not just what we do, it’s how we do it.

APAR: Leading the Electron beam Revolution in India

Since 2011, APAR has been at the forefront of E-beam technology, revolutionizing cable performance. With five state-of-the-art E-beam accelerators (1.5 MeV, 2×2.5 MeV, 3 MeV), APAR has cemented its position as a leader in this advanced field. The Science Behind the E-beam Strength!

Think of cable insulation as being made of tiny Lego bricks (polymers). E-beam technology acts like a super glue, creating stronger bonds between those bricks. This makes the insulation:

  • More Heat Resistant: Handles higher temperatures without melting or degrading.
  • APAR Anushakti cables can operate at an impressive 105°C.
  • More Durable: Resists abrasion and wear and tear.
  • Longer Lasting: Extends the operational lifespan of the cable.
  • Anushakti Cables offers life up to 50 years while carrying 50% more current.

APAR Anushakti: Performance You Can Trust

The APAR ANUSHAKTI house wire exemplifies innovation by meeting international standards while exceeding basic requirements set by IS: 694. This product is melt-resistant, fire-retardant, and designed for longevity—offering up to 50 years of life while carrying 50% more current than conventional wires.
